PHILIPPE HALSMAN (1906–1979)
Professor Albert Einstein in his Study at Princeton, 1947
gelatin silver print, printed c. 1970
signed, titled and dated in pencil, stamped photographer's copyright credit (verso)
image: 13 5/8 x 10 1/2 in. (34.5 x 26.6 cm.)
sheet: 14 x 11 in. (35.7 x 28 cm.)
Provenance
Private collection, Salt Lake City, Utah;
acquired from the above by the present owner, c. 2000.
